For example, if you want to make … Web28 okt. 2024 · Ideally, you can proof sourdough in the fridge for up to 36 hours, or even longer if your dough will tolerate it. You don't want to have the gluten structure break down or for the dough to use up all of its energy before it hits the oven. This will result in poor oven spring. Web29 okt. 2024 · Once the dry ingredients are added, less mixing equals more tender cookies. 3. Not chilling the dough. Chilling the dough is a key step in making sugar cookies, especially when you’re making cut-outs. Even if you’re tight on time, make sure to get the dough in the fridge, or even the freezer, even if it’s only for a little while. Make sure they are not touching each … twisted fey quest neverwinterWeb23 aug. 2024 · Chill the dough Once your pastry dough is fitted in the tart pan let it chill for at least 30 minutes in the refrigerator or 5 minutes in the freezer. This is really important and helps the gluten relax in the dough so the dough will not shrink, and chills the butter. This means a great-looking tart dough.
